Part III - Narrative
Initio, Inc. (the "Company") is unable to timely file Form 10-KSB for
the period ended April 30, 1998 because of an accident and resultant
surgery, last week to the mother of the President of the Company.
Filing is expected this week, but not necessarily before July 30, 1998.

INITIO LAUNCHES INTERNET MARKETING PROGRAM,
RELEASES ANNUAL STATEMENT
Carson City, NV, July 27, 1998 -- Initio, Inc. (NASDAQ: INTO) Announced
today that its first four Internet sites, developed in conjunction with RR
Donnelley, are all "up and ready for shopping." The first four sites are as
follows:
WWW.housenet.com
WWW.homearts.com
WWW.ivillage.com
WWW.weddingchannel.com
Initio's exclusive Deerskin site is progressing as originally planned and is
expected to be operational within 60 days. While Initio remains committed
to consumer cataloging by mail, the Company believes that Internet responses
will significantly add to sales and profitability in the near future.
Initio also released year end figures, reporting a loss for the year ended
April 30, 1998 of $178,589 (or $0.04 per share) before an extraordinary,
non-recurring charge of approximately $600,000, compared with a loss of
$124,187 (or $0.03 per share) for the fiscal year ended April 30, 1997.
For the 12 months ended:
April 30, 1998 April 30, 1997
-------------- --------------
Net Sales $11,133,544 $12,089,517
Net Loss ($804,589) (a) ($124,187)
Loss per share
Basic ($0.17) (a) ($0.03)
Diluted ($0.16) (a) ($0.03)
Average Shares
Basic 4,842,737 4,681,280
Diluted 4,886,321 4,681,280
(a) includes restructuring charges of $611,000 or $0.13 per share
The Company stated that the one time non-recurring charge of approximately
$600,000 was taken to set up a reserve for the cost of closing and moving
expenses of its Massachusetts operations, the set-up costs for the planned
consolidation of all mail/telephone room functions into its company owned
building in Nevada, and a reserve for the quick sale of inventory at its
retail store location.
Management expects the consolidating of all mail order fulfillment operations
and the closing of the Massachusetts retail store to result in substantial
cost-saving efficiencies in the immediate future.
Through the DEERSKIN Catalog, Initio markets a line of fine leather apparel
and accessories. This line dominates its niche of the mail-order industry.
Through the JOAN COOK catalog, Initio offers housewares, home furnishings,
and gifts. While Initio remains committed to consumer cataloging by mail,
it anticipates that Internet responses will significantly add to the
Company's sales and profitability in the near future.
